Understanding Cesium Carbonate

Cesium carbonate is an inorganic compound with the formula Cs2CO3. It boasts a variety of beneficial characteristics, which make it invaluable in several industrial processes. Derived from the alkali metal cesium, this compound presents unique benefits that many industries can leverage.

1. Applications in Glass Manufacturing

One of the most significant applications of cesium carbonate is in the production of specialty glasses. Its low melting point and high thermal stability make it an ideal additive for improving the durability and optical clarity of glass products. This is especially valuable in sectors like telecommunications and electronics, where high-performance materials are essential.

2. Role in Organic Synthesis

Cesium carbonate is a potent base used in organic reactions, such as nucleophilic substitutions and carbon-carbon bond formations. Its capacity to facilitate such reactions efficiently is beneficial in creating complex organic molecules, making it advantageous for pharmaceutical development and chemical manufacturing.
